Well patalavaca is just past arguinegan on the way to puerto rico,
so you can go either way for your entertainment or walk down to the beach and straight on along it until you come to the anfi timeshare complex The beach there and its bars are public and quite well worth walking to. A pleasant surprise. You can walk from patalavaca into arguinegan plenty to do there, or take the bus or a short taxi ride into puerto rico, The choice is yours.

I stayed in Patalavaca a couple of years ago at the GReen Beach , to be honest it is very dead with a few bars and the pizza place i presume Mary mentions (sorry Mary we found it disgusting) , there is a Spar which was well stocked and teh Jukebox BUT nothing else bar very small quiet spanish bars
as for Anfi , i wouldnt reccomend it its very expensive and you will get pestered by the anfi workers , we did
to say how expensive it is my mate said on teh first night he would buy the drinks for getting him teh holiday at standby staff rates for the company i worked at , HE SPENT MORE IN THAT ONE NIGHT THAN HIS HOLIDAY COST
geta taxi to PR €3 each way at the time , , there is a rank in teh centre of the village buy the roundabout
